## Memory Ballast
In compute constrained environments, garbage collection can become a significant factor. This can be optimised, at the expense of memory consumption, by configuring a memory ballast using the `ballast_bytes` configuration option.

A larger memory ballast will mean that standard heap size volatility is less relatively significant, and therefore less likely to trigger garbage collection. This will result in lower compute overhead, but higher memory consumption, as the heap is cleaned less frequently.

We use sentence case for headers. Here's my rewrite of this section of prose:

Memory ballast

In compute-constrained environments, garbage collection can become a significant performance factor. Frequently-run garbage collection interferes with running the application by using CPU resources. The use of memory ballast can mitigate the issue. Memory ballast allocates extra, but unused virtual memory in order to inflate the quantity of live heap space. Garbage collection is triggered by the growth of heap space usage. The inflated quantity of heap space reduces the perceived growth, so garbage collection occurs less frequently.

Configure memory ballast using the ballast_bytes configuration option.
